@David Woodhouse: p11-kit-trust.so only handles CA certificates; it does not pull in the PKCS#11 security module configuration, which is stored in the system-wide NSS database. This is required where smart cards are used (using security modules such as OpenSC, either directly or via the p11-kit-proxy security module). This was part of the issue reported with this bug. As it stands now, the PKCS#11 module configuration still has to be manually added to every Firefox/Thunderbird profile after the application is first launched by the user and the NSS databases are created at that time.
